Kanda Express Brings Subsidised Onions to Delhi Amid Price Rise

Kanda Express Brings Subsidised Onions to Delhi Amid Price Rise
Government To Sell Onions At ₹35/Kg In Delhi, Kanda Express Brings 800 Tonnes Wednesday · freepressjournal.in

The government is sending a special train called Kanda Express to Delhi with about 800 tonnes of onions.

The train is expected to arrive on Wednesday, although one report said it could arrive on Wednesday or Thursday.

The onions will be sold for Rs 35 per kilogram at selected government-linked stores.

This is cheaper than the average Delhi price of about Rs 55 per kilogram.

Other trains are carrying onions to Chennai, Ernakulam, Madurai and Guwahati.

The onions come from a reserve kept by the government in Nashik, Maharashtra.

The reserve is used when prices rise or supplies become tighter.

The government says onion supplies should remain comfortable in the coming months, but prices often rise seasonally around August and September.

Key facts

Delhi shipment
About 800 tonnes of onions
Subsidised price
Rs 35 per kilogram
Delhi retail channels
NAFED, NCCF and Kendriya Bhandar stores; NCCF sources also cited 10 outlets and 105 Bharat Brand stores
Delhi average retail price
Rs 55 per kilogram on the cited Tuesday, compared with Rs 35 a year earlier
All-India retail price
Rs 43.53 per kilogram on August 24, up 59% year-on-year and 24.3% from a month earlier
Kanda Express expansion
From 14 rakes carrying nearly 12,000 tonnes in 2024-25 to 86 rakes carrying about 88,000 tonnes in 2025-26
Strategic reserve
About 1.21 lakh tonnes of onion buffer stock maintained for 2026
Production outlook
Estimated 2025-26 production of 307.37 lakh tonnes, broadly matching 307.67 lakh tonnes the previous year

Quotes

Nidhi Khare

Consumer affairs secretary who announced the subsidized onion distribution

“Initially, the onion will be supplied to five major consumption centres, namely Chennai, Madurai, Delhi, Ernakulam and Guwahati, with additional destinations to be included subsequently based on emerging market requirements.”
